Otherwise called “bunny fever,” the bacterial illness causes fever, skin ulcers, and enlarged, excruciating lymph organs

JEFFERSON Province, Colo. — A human instance of tularemia, a bacterial illness that for the most part spreads among rodents and bugs, has been found in Jefferson Region, general wellbeing authorities said recently.

The case was accounted for in a Wheat Edge occupant and was the principal human reason for tularemia in the district in 2024, as per a representative with Jefferson Region General Wellbeing.

The illness, otherwise called “hare fever,” is brought about by the bacterium Francisella tularensis and generally influences rodents and bunnies, as well as bugs like ticks and deerflies. It tends to be communicated to people, in any case, through the nibbles of tainted creatures or bugs, as well as through the ingesting of debased water or food and airborne microorganisms.

“While tularemia is uncommon, occupants actually should know about the side effects and go to preventive lengths,” said Rachel Reichardt, a natural wellbeing expert with Jefferson Region General Wellbeing.

Side effects incorporate fever, non-recuperating skin ulcer at the site of disease, and enlarged and agonizing lymph organs, the representative said.

If the disease is brought about by ingesting tainted food or water, the side effects incorporate a sensitive throat, mouth wounds, stomach torment, and runs. If microscopic organisms are breathed in, pneumonia can create side effects including fever, chills, cerebral pain, muscle hurts, dry hack, and moderate shortcomings, the representative added

Region well-being authorities prescribe inhabitants find the accompanying ways to forestall openness:

  • Use bug repellent during all open-air movement.
  • Keep away from all contact with wild rodents.
  • Feed or tempt no rat or bunny into your yard or deck.
  • Take out heaps of timber, garbage, and weeds around your home.
  • Try not to contact debilitated or dead creatures or wear gloves if vital.
  • Try not to cut over dead creatures.
  • Try not to hydrate (lakes, lakes, waterways).
  • Make certain to cook meat completely before eating.
  • Keep pets on a chain while in regions where contact with natural life is conceivable.
  • Counsel veterinarian for any pet collaboration.

Give quick veterinary consideration to debilitated pets and don’t deal with wiped-out pets without utilizing hand and face insurance

Tularemia can be dealt with effectively and restored, however, you’re encouraged to see your medical care supplier assuming you experience any side effects related to tularemia in the wake of being in regions where contact with untamed life is conceivable.

Just nine human instances of tularemia were found in Colorado last year, as per the Colorado Branch of General Wellbeing and Climate (CDPHE).
